Responsibilities of the Township Police Department
The DeWitt Charter Township Police Department provides police services to residents and businesses on a full-time basis. Our entire Department is dedicated to providing superior law enforcement and public service in an effort to maintain a high quality of life in our community.
The Department is comprised
of a Chief of Police, a Lieutenant, two Sergeants, a Detective,
and eleven Patrol Officers (including two K-9 teams). Our administrative
staff provides professional office support to these sworn personnel.
The Chief of Police oversees all aspects of the Police Department
operation both directly and through the Command staff.

Police Department Mission Statement
The DeWitt Charter Township Police Department is committed to delivering cost effective, efficient law enforcement services to the citizens of DeWitt Charter Township. To this end, this Department will provide police protection, investigations and prevention, code enforcement and other related services. We strive to enhance the image of this Department by dedicating ourselves to excellence in the delivery of these services.
